Transaction 24efddc82d99f7d128b59610535ea97d7ad05a3e15e40f45c725a8e226211a4a

1 Input
2 Outputs
  • 24efddc82d99f7d128b59610535ea97d7ad05a3e15e40f45c725a8e226211a4a:0
  • value  7283509
    address  3A4AANECXEkVjTQ8hWGzuMfBVABLSnmRRA
  • 24efddc82d99f7d128b59610535ea97d7ad05a3e15e40f45c725a8e226211a4a:1
  • value  24698898
    address  397R8JMict2hcKfnV2D5cLXkZ4hybkvRvM